In the last years, the olive oil sector showed a great dynamics and oils with Protected Designation of Origin (PDO) and varietal olive oils are introduced in the market. "Azeite de Trás-os-Montes" PDO is a result of a mixture of different olive cultivars mainly Cvs. Cobrançosa, Madural and Verdeal Transmontana, being allowed the presence of other cultivars in few amounts. In the present work we intend lo contribute for a better knowledge 01 the most representative cultivars 01 Olea europaea L grown in Trás-os-Montes namely Cobrançosa (24 samples), Verdeal Transmontana (15), Madurai (15), Negrinha de Freixo (14), Santulhana (10), Cordovil (10), Borrenta (2), Bical (1), Cordovesa (1), Lentisca (1) and Madurai Negra (1), concerning the moisture and fat contents in olives, some qualitative parameters (acidity, absorbance coefficients, and peroxide value) and fatty acids, triacylglycerols and tocopherols profiles in the oils. Fat contents ranged lrom 47.2% to 70.3% 01 dry matter. Quality parameters were inside of legal limits defined for "Azeite de Trás-os-Montes" PDO, and monounsaturated fatty acids were predominant, particularly oleic acid pne (68.6 - 82.6%). Among the triacylglycerols identified, 1 ,2,3-trioleoylglycerol (000) was the major (38.1 - 64.0%). The lour isomers of tocopherol (a-, ~-, y- and 5- tocopherol) were identified in the samples.
